What is ruby-combustion

ruby-combustion is:

Ruby ‘combustion’ is a library to help you test your Rails Engines in a simple and effective manner, instead of creating a full Rails application in your spec or test folder.

It allows you to write your specs within the context of your engine, using only the parts of a Rails app you need.

Install ruby-combustion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install ruby-combustion using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install ruby-combustion

How To Uninstall ruby-combustion on Ubuntu 18.04

To uninstall only the ruby-combustion package we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get remove ruby-combustion

Uninstall ruby-combustion And Its Dependencies

To uninstall ruby-combustion and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Ubuntu 18.04, we can use the command below: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ove ruby-combustion

Remove ruby-combustion Configurations and Data

To remove ruby-combustion configuration and data from Ubuntu 18.04 we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y purge ruby-combustion

Remove ruby-combustion configuration, data, and all of its dependencies

We can use the following command to remove ruby-combustion config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ge ruby-combustion
